暗号資産 (仮想通貨)のライトニングネットワークとは?送金高速化の秘訣
暗号資産(仮想通貨)の世界において、送金速度と手数料は、その普及を阻む大きな課題の一つでした。特にビットコインのような主要な暗号資産では、ブロックチェーンの特性上、取引の承認に時間がかかり、手数料も高騰することがあります。この課題を解決するために開発されたのが、ライトニングネットワークです。本稿では、ライトニングネットワークの仕組み、利点、課題、そして将来展望について、詳細に解説します。
1. ライトニングネットワークの誕生背景
ビットコインは、分散型台帳技術であるブロックチェーンを基盤としています。ブロックチェーンは、取引履歴を記録する公開されたデータベースであり、その安全性と透明性が特徴です。しかし、ブロックチェーンの構造上、取引の承認には一定の時間がかかります。これは、ブロックチェーンに新しいブロックを追加するためには、ネットワーク参加者(マイナー)による合意形成が必要であり、そのプロセスに時間がかかるためです。また、取引が増加すると、ブロックチェーンの容量が限界に達し、手数料が高騰する問題も発生します。
これらの課題を解決するために、ジョセフ・プーンとタッド・ジェンセンによって、2015年にライトニングネットワークのホワイトペーパーが発表されました。ライトニングネットワークは、ブロックチェーン上での直接的な取引を減らし、オフチェーンでの取引を可能にすることで、送金速度を向上させ、手数料を削減することを目的としています。
2. ライトニングネットワークの仕組み
ライトニングネットワークは、主に以下の要素で構成されています。
2.1. 支払いチャネル (Payment Channel)
支払いチャネルとは、2人以上の参加者が、特定の暗号資産について、ブロックチェーン上で資金をロックし、その資金を使ってオフチェーンで繰り返し取引を行うための仕組みです。支払いチャネルを開設する際には、ブロックチェーン上に取引を記録する必要がありますが、その後の取引はオフチェーンで行われるため、ブロックチェーンの負荷を軽減できます。
2.2. ハッシュタイムロック契約 (Hash Time Locked Contract, HTLC)
HTLCは、ライトニングネットワークにおける安全な取引を実現するための重要な技術です。HTLCは、ある条件を満たした場合にのみ、資金が解放されるように設定されたスマートコントラクトです。具体的には、あるハッシュ値を知っている人が、一定時間内にそのハッシュ値を提供した場合にのみ、資金が解放されるように設定されます。これにより、取引相手が約束を守らない場合でも、資金を安全に保護することができます。
2.3. ルーティング (Routing)
ライトニングネットワークでは、直接支払いチャネルを持たない相手にも送金することができます。これは、複数の支払いチャネルを介して、間接的に送金を行うルーティングという仕組みによって実現されます。ルーティングを行う際には、ネットワーク上のノードが、最適な経路を探し、送金を仲介します。このプロセスは、ネットワークの規模が大きくなるほど複雑になりますが、効率的なルーティングアルゴリズムによって、スムーズな送金が可能になります。
3. ライトニングネットワークの利点
ライトニングネットワークは、従来のブロックチェーンベースの暗号資産送金と比較して、以下の利点があります。
3.1. 高速な送金
ライトニングネットワークでは、オフチェーンで取引を行うため、ブロックチェーンの承認を待つ必要がありません。これにより、送金速度が大幅に向上し、ほぼ瞬時に送金が完了します。
3.2. 低コストな手数料
ライトニングネットワークでは、ブロックチェーン上での取引回数を減らすことができるため、手数料を大幅に削減できます。特に少額の取引においては、手数料が従来の送金方法よりも格段に安くなります。
3.3. スケーラビリティの向上
ライトニングネットワークは、ブロックチェーンの負荷を軽減し、スケーラビリティを向上させることができます。これにより、より多くの取引を処理できるようになり、暗号資産の普及を促進することができます。
3.4. プライバシーの向上
ライトニングネットワークでは、取引の詳細がブロックチェーン上に記録されないため、プライバシーを向上させることができます。ただし、ルーティングを行うノードは、取引の中継を行う際に、ある程度の情報を知ることができます。
4. ライトニングネットワークの課題
ライトニングネットワークは、多くの利点を持つ一方で、いくつかの課題も抱えています。
4.1. 流動性の問題
ライトニングネットワークでは、支払いチャネルに十分な資金を確保しておく必要があります。流動性が不足している場合、送金が遅延したり、失敗したりする可能性があります。
4.2. 複雑な技術
ライトニングネットワークの仕組みは複雑であり、一般ユーザーにとっては理解しにくい場合があります。また、ライトニングネットワークを利用するためには、専用のウォレットやソフトウェアが必要となります。
4.3. ネットワークの規模
ライトニングネットワークの規模が小さい場合、ルーティングが困難になり、送金が遅延したり、失敗したりする可能性があります。ネットワークの規模を拡大するためには、より多くのノードが参加する必要があります。
4.4. セキュリティリスク
ライトニングネットワークは、比較的新しい技術であり、セキュリティリスクが完全に排除されているわけではありません。特に、HTLCの脆弱性や、ルーティングノードの悪意のある行為による攻撃のリスクが懸念されています。
5. ライトニングネットワークの将来展望
ライトニングネットワークは、暗号資産の普及を促進するための重要な技術として、今後ますます発展していくことが期待されます。現在、ライトニングネットワークの開発は活発に進められており、様々な改善が加えられています。例えば、流動性の問題を解決するための新しい技術や、より使いやすいウォレットの開発が進められています。また、ライトニングネットワークの規模を拡大するために、様々な取り組みが行われています。これらの取り組みによって、ライトニングネットワークは、より安全で、高速で、低コストな暗号資産送金を実現し、暗号資産の普及に大きく貢献することが期待されます。
さらに、ライトニングネットワークは、単なる送金手段にとどまらず、様々なアプリケーションへの応用が期待されています。例えば、マイクロペイメント、ストリーミングサービス、分散型ソーシャルメディアなど、様々な分野でライトニングネットワークを活用した新しいサービスが登場する可能性があります。
6. まとめ
ライトニングネットワークは、暗号資産の送金速度と手数料の問題を解決するための革新的な技術です。オフチェーンでの取引を可能にすることで、高速かつ低コストな送金を実現し、暗号資産の普及を促進することが期待されます。しかし、流動性の問題、複雑な技術、ネットワークの規模、セキュリティリスクなどの課題も抱えています。これらの課題を克服し、ライトニングネットワークの規模を拡大するためには、更なる開発と普及活動が必要です。ライトニングネットワークは、暗号資産の未来を形作る重要な要素の一つとして、今後ますます注目されていくでしょう。



